Air India cabin crew call for pending dues

Mumbai: Air India flight attendants have claimed that while in the last two days, the airline has been paying its pilots their outstanding allowance and dues, but the cabin crew members have been overlooked. Air India Cabin Crew Association complained about the discrimination in a letter sent to the airline management on February 29, 2012.
“We should not be held responsible if the cabin crew express their inability to operate flights due to lack of money/resources to sustain themselves at all outstations as was done in the month of January 2012,” the letter said, as per a Times of India report.
The association demanded immediate payment of pending sustenance allowance for a period of two months as the pilots' dues for two months have been cleared.
